Output 44d216528431522f6e3a775d6a4d55eb0215948334c8a0677bb392aee243e7ec:0

value
22221044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fae27572e95dc7598ff6d14f70a30aaf57e10ab0 OP_EQUALVERIFY OP_CHECKSIG
address
1PsZDbD7ydNVC73T2HWWoZ4shweDuyPvu9
transaction
44d216528431522f6e3a775d6a4d55eb0215948334c8a0677bb392aee243e7ec
confirmations
669295
spent
true